diff options
author | chai <chaifix@163.com> | 2021-09-16 20:51:19 +0800 |
---|---|---|
committer | chai <chaifix@163.com> | 2021-09-16 20:51:19 +0800 |
commit | cec37ddb003304a224b804a78479ae46dae58fed (patch) | |
tree | 03cb1ebba64cf6c38e9250816a7a4a4d13e36e38 /Assets/Scripts/Unit/AnimationData.cs | |
parent | 8b65edb43be0945203633b33d7a62c81ab3f05ce (diff) |
+ motion blur
Diffstat (limited to 'Assets/Scripts/Unit/AnimationData.cs')
-rw-r--r-- | Assets/Scripts/Unit/AnimationData.cs |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/Assets/Scripts/Unit/AnimationData.cs b/Assets/Scripts/Unit/AnimationData.cs index 784acf05..9af3d51c 100644 --- a/Assets/Scripts/Unit/AnimationData.cs +++ b/Assets/Scripts/Unit/AnimationData.cs @@ -437,6 +437,8 @@ public class AnimationData : ScriptableObject events.Clear();
foreach (var animeEvent in animationEvents)
{
+ if (animeEvent == null)
+ continue;
if(animeEvent.startFrame == frame)
{
events.Add(animeEvent);
@@ -476,6 +478,8 @@ public class AnimationData : ScriptableObject frames.Clear();
foreach (var animeEvent in animationEvents)
{
+ if (animeEvent == null)
+ continue;
if (!frames.Contains(animeEvent.startFrame))
{
frames.Add(animeEvent.startFrame);
@@ -509,6 +513,8 @@ public class AnimationData : ScriptableObject {
foreach(var animEvent in animationEvents)
{
+ if (animEvent == null)
+ continue;
if(!AssetDatabase.IsSubAsset(animEvent))
{
AssetDatabase.AddObjectToAsset(animEvent, this);
|